JUST RADIO LIMITED
Just Radio is one of the country’s most respected independent radio production companies. In business since 1995, we have an unbroken record for making high quality, award winning programmes for BBC Radio1, Radio 2, Radio 3, Radio 4 and the World Service along with audio and visual material for the Open University, the British Academy and a range of other non-broadcast clients.

Just Style
Launched in 1999 just-style.com is an online resource for the apparel and textile industry, providing information, insights and intelligence. just-style.com is also a major publisher of market research. The website also includes discussion forums, blogs, targeted email alerts and career opportunities among additional interactive features as well as a range of reports, studies and profiles. The website is mainly aimed at apparel and textile executives.
